Pimples, commonly known as zits or acne lesions, are small, inflamed bumps on the skin's surface that result in hair follicles clogging with excess oil and dead skin cells, creating a breeding ground for bacteria. Pimples can vary in size and severity, from tiny whiteheads or blackheads to larger, red and painful cystic acne. Various factors contribute to pimple development, including hormonal changes, genetics, and skincare habits.

What causes Pimples on the cheeks?

The pimple specialist doctors claim that pimples on the cheeks, like all other types of acne, are mainly caused due to overproduction of oil by the sebaceous glands, leading to clogging of the hair follicles and the development of inflammatory lesions. Factors that contribute to the occurrence of pimples on the cheeks include:

  • Excess oil production that mixes with dead skin cells and blocks the hair follicles
  • Bacterial growth and rapid multiplication of bacteria cause inflammation
  • Dead skin cells accumulate and mix with sebum, leading to clogged pores
  • Genetic factors such as family history
  • Cosmetic products or skincare products can clog pores and worsen or cause acne

How long do Pimples last?

Pimples specialists explain that acne duration depends on various factors such as the type, severity, skin type of the individual, the kind of treatment given, when it is initiated, and the individual's response to the treatment given. Depending on the type of acne that is present, the duration of acne can be as follows:

  • Whiteheads and Blackheads: These are non-inflammatory lesions that last for a shorter period ranging from a few days to a couple of weeks
  • Papules and Pustules: These are small red or pink bumps that contain pus and are inflammatory lesions that last a little longer and may stay for a week or two in most cases
  • Nodules and Cysts are more severe, extensive, painful bumps beneath the skin's surface and can last for several weeks, and in some cases, they may take months to heal fully

How can I remove Pimples naturally at home?

Doctors for pimples specialists advise that to ensure that pimples are appropriately managed at home, one has to follow consistent and gentle skin care practices that prevent excess oil production, keep the pore unclogged, and promote healing. Some measures initiated by the best doctors for pimples treatment in Hyderabad that can be taken at home to manage pimples include:

  • Clean the affected area by washing your face twice daily with a mild, non-comedogenic cleanser to remove dirt, excess oil, and impurities
  • Avoid harsh soaps or aggressive scrubbing, as they irritate the skin and worsen acne
  • Steaming your face gently opens up pores and facilitates the removal of impurities
  • Avoid touching or picking, as picking can lead to scarring and prolong the healing process
  • Dietary adjustments that reduce high-glycemic foods, dairy, and sugary items intake

Pimples specialists say that pimples can last up to a week before they resolve, and in severe forms can persist for a few weeks. Commonly appearing in the teenage years, this condition resolves in most by the time they reach adulthood, but it may persist and be chronic in others.

Pimples treatment specialists say that not popping the pimple helps to reduce the risk of secondary infection and scarring, and the pimple is more likely to resolve faster without leaving any scars.

Although not directly responsible for the development of acne, stress can contribute to the worsening of the condition, by increasing the activity of the immune system and worsening existing inflammation.

Pimples are caused when the hair follicle and its accompanying oil producing gland are blocked with oil and dead cells, which leads to increased bacterial activity and the development of inflammation.

Doctors for pimples treatment advise that it is important to know your skin type and choose the right skin care products accordingly. It is also recommended to gently cleanse the face, avoid harsh chemicals and cosmetics, use moisturizers, avoid excessive sun exposure, and avoid touching the face to reduce the risk of pimple outbreaks.
